Eastern Iowa Antique Tractor Pullers Assoc.
Have farm stock class, 3.5 mph class, and 6mph class. Pulls usually start in June and last til Oct. Last year there were pulls in Davenport, Tipton, Clarence, Grand Mound, Anamosa, and Walcott. Eastern Iowa Antique Pulling Club - Hearquarters out of Dubuque, Iowa. About 150 to 200 pulls per day. Contact me in May and I can let you know our schedule. A good group of people. Have standard rpm pulls. Farm class is 1st gear only no wheelie bars and antique class is any gear with speed limit and wheelie bars required.
